#!/usr/bin/env python
# Copyright (c) Streamlit Inc. (2018-2022) Snowflake Inc. (2022-2025)
#
# Licensed under the Apache License, Version 2.0 (the "License");
# you may not use this file except in compliance with the License.
# You may obtain a copy of the License at
#
# http://www.apache.org/licenses/LICENSE-2.0
#
# Unless required by applicable law or agreed to in writing, software
# distributed under the License is distributed on an "AS IS" BASIS,
# W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
# See the License for the specific language governing permissions and
# limitations under the License.
import os
import subprocess
from typing import Final, TypedDict
MAKE_COMMANDS_CURSOR_RULE_TEMPLATE: Final[str] = """---
description: List of all available make commands
globs:
alwaysApply: false
---
# Available `make` commands
List of all `make` commands that are available for execution from the repository root folder:
{make_commands}
"""
CURSOR_RULE_TEMPLATE_GLOBS: Final[str] = """---
description:
globs: {globs}
alwaysApply: false
---
{agents_md_content}
"""
CURSOR_RULE_TEMPLATE_GLOBAL: Final[str] = """---
description:
globs:
alwaysApply: true
---
{agents_md_content}
"""
GITHUB_COPILOT_RULE_TEMPLATE_GLOBS: Final[str] = """---
applyTo: "{globs}"
---
{agents_md_content}
"""
GITHUB_COPILOT_RULE_TEMPLATE_GLOBAL: Final[str] = """{agents_md_content}
"""
class AgentRuleFile(TypedDict):
cursor_mdc: str
agents_md: str
globs: str
github_copilot: str
always_apply: bool
AGENT_RULE_FILES: Final[list[AgentRuleFile]] = [
{
"cursor_mdc": ".cursor/rules/e2e_playwright.mdc",
"github_copilot": ".github/instructions/e2e_playwright.instructions.md",
"agents_md": "e2e_playwright/AGENTS.md",
"globs": "e2e_playwright/**/*.py",
"always_apply": False,
},
{
"cursor_mdc": ".cursor/rules/python.mdc",
"github_copilot": ".github/instructions/python.instructions.md",
"agents_md": "lib/AGENTS.md",
"globs": "**/*.py",
"always_apply": False,
},
{
"cursor_mdc": ".cursor/rules/python_lib.mdc",
"github_copilot": ".github/instructions/python_lib.instructions.md",
"agents_md": "lib/streamlit/AGENTS.md",
"globs": "lib/streamlit/**/*.py",
"always_apply": False,
},
{
"cursor_mdc": ".cursor/rules/python_tests.mdc",
"github_copilot": ".github/instructions/python_tests.instructions.md",
"agents_md": "lib/tests/AGENTS.md",
"globs": "lib/tests/**/*.py",
"always_apply": False,
},
{
"cursor_mdc": ".cursor/rules/protobuf.mdc",
"github_copilot": ".github/instructions/protobuf.instructions.md",
"agents_md": "proto/streamlit/proto/AGENTS.md",
"globs": "**/*.proto",
"always_apply": False,
},
{
"cursor_mdc": ".cursor/rules/typescript.mdc",
"github_copilot": ".github/instructions/typescript.instructions.md",
"agents_md": "frontend/AGENTS.md",
"globs": "**/*.ts, **/*.tsx",
"always_apply": False,
},
{
"cursor_mdc": ".cursor/rules/overview.mdc",
# Use repository-wide instructions file:
"github_copilot": ".github/copilot-instructions.md",
"agents_md": "AGENTS.md",
"globs": "**",
"always_apply": True,
},
]
def generate_make_commands_rule() -> None:
"""Generate the make commands cursor rule file."""
# Determine workspace root and run `make help` without directory trace noise
workspace_root = os.path.dirname(os.path.dirname(os.path.abspath(__file__)))
result = subprocess.run(
["make", "--no-print-directory", "help"],
capture_output=True,
text=True,
check=True,
cwd=workspace_root,
)
make_commands = result.stdout.strip()
# Format the template with the make commands
formatted_content = MAKE_COMMANDS_CURSOR_RULE_TEMPLATE.format(
make_commands=make_commands
)
# Define the output path
output_dir = os.path.join(workspace_root, ".cursor", "rules")
os.makedirs(output_dir, exist_ok=True)
output_path = os.path.join(output_dir, "make_commands.mdc")
# Write the formatted content to the file
with open(output_path, "w") as f:
f.write(formatted_content)
print(f"Generated rule file: {output_path}")
def resolve_rule_path(rule_path: str) -> str:
workspace_root = os.path.dirname(os.path.dirname(os.path.abspath(__file__)))
output_path = os.path.join(workspace_root, rule_path)
output_dir = os.path.dirname(output_path)
os.makedirs(output_dir, exist_ok=True)
return output_path
def generate_agent_rules() -> None:
"""Generate Cursor and Github Copilot agent rule files based on AGENT_RULE_FILES."""
for rule in AGENT_RULE_FILES:
cursor_mdc_path = resolve_rule_path(rule["cursor_mdc"])
github_copilot_path = resolve_rule_path(rule["github_copilot"])
agents_md_path = resolve_rule_path(rule["agents_md"])
globs = rule["globs"]
always_apply = rule["always_apply"]
if not os.path.isfile(agents_md_path):
raise FileNotFoundError(f"Missing AGENTS.md file at '{agents_md_path}'.")
# Read the full content of the AGENTS.md file
with open(agents_md_path) as f:
agents_md_content = f.read()
# Write cursor rule file:
if always_apply:
content = CURSOR_RULE_TEMPLATE_GLOBAL.format(
agents_md_content=agents_md_content.strip(),
)
else:
content = CURSOR_RULE_TEMPLATE_GLOBS.format(
globs=globs, agents_md_content=agents_md_content.strip()
)
with open(cursor_mdc_path, "w") as f:
f.write(content)
print(f"Generated Cursor rule file: {cursor_mdc_path}")
# Write github copilot rule file:
if always_apply:
content = GITHUB_COPILOT_RULE_TEMPLATE_GLOBAL.format(
agents_md_content=agents_md_content.strip(),
)
else:
content = GITHUB_COPILOT_RULE_TEMPLATE_GLOBS.format(
globs=globs, agents_md_content=agents_md_content.strip()
)
with open(github_copilot_path, "w") as f:
f.write(content)
print(f"Generated GitHub Copilot rule file: {github_copilot_path}")
if __name__ == "__main__":
generate_make_commands_rule()
generate_agent_rules()
